2. Empowering Local Communities
A critical aspect of sustainable tourism is uplifting local communities. This can be achieved by engaging in community-based tours and purchasing handcrafted goods, which supports local businesses.
Cultural Experiences: Engage in cultural practices by attending community events and interacting with local residents.
Ethical Purchases: Always verify that the gifts and items you purchase are ethically sourced and help the craftsmen.
3. Adopting Green Practices While Traveling
Travelers can promote sustainability by practicing environmentally friendly habits during their trips.
Waste Reduction: Carry reusable bottles and avoid single-use plastics.
Resource Conservation: Use efficiently water and electricity by reducing consumption in accommodations.
